" SEC. 307. OTHER FIXANCING.—When it appears to the Adminis-

trator that the loan applicant is able to obtain a loan for part of his credit needs from a responsible cooperative or other credit source at reasonable rates and terms consistent with the loan applicant's ability to pay and the achievement of the Act's objectives, he may request the loan applicant to apply for and accept such a loan concurrently with a loan insured at the standard rate, subject, however, to full use being made by the Administrator of the funds made available hereunder for such insured loans under this title. Section 405 of the Rural Electrification Act of 1936, as 85 Stat. 32. amended, is further amended by striking subsection (e) in its entirety 7 USC 945. and by inserting in lieu thereof a new subsection (e), as follows: "(e) Thereafter, the cooperative-type entities and organizations holding class B and class C stock, voting as a separate class, shall elect three directors to represent their class by a majority vote of the stockholders voting in such class; and the commercial-type entities and organizations holding class B and class C stock, voting as a separate class, shall elect three directors to represent their class by a majority vote of the stockholders voting in such class. Limited proxy voting may be permitted, as authorized by the bylaws of the telephone bank. Cumulative voting shall not be permitted." SEC. 5.
